Pokémon TCG Pocket's Next Set Leaks Making Fans Anxious About Having Even More Cards To Collect
It's only been a month since Pokémon TCG Pocket's Diamond and Pearl-inspired Space-Time Smackdown expansion released, and it looks like the mobile card game's next set of cards is already here. A promo for a set called Triumphant Light, starring the god Pokémon Arceus, appeared to leak overnight. Now fans with unfinished collections are already freaking out about all of the new cards they'll need to collect.
That anxiety is a natural part of Pokémon TCG Pocket, a game with battle and trading mechanics that remains predominantly focused on the joy and frustration of opening digital card packs to complete full sets. I was personally feeling pretty good in early December when I had most of the Genetic Apex launch set finished, outside of some super rare cards. Then Mythical Island dropped later that month, followed by Space-Time Smackdown in late January. My virtual card binder is now full of holes, and Triumphant Light will only make that worse.
The set was referenced in a now-deleted promotional video on TikTok that showed a new Arceus EX card with 140HP and the abilities Fabled Luster and Ultimate Force. The god Pokémon was at the center of 2022's Pokémon Legends: Arceus and the rest of the set will seemingly take inspiration from the Hisui region's past. We'll know better once the set is likely revealed in full during the February 27 Pokémon Day showcase.
'I'm hoping this fake cause ppl need time to get the cards from other sets still,' wrote one player on X. It definitely doesn't seem fake, but I share the rest of the sentiment. I've fallen off Pokémon TCG Pocket pretty hard in recent weeks, in part because it feels like my pulls in Space-Time Smackdown have been demonstrably worse on average than when the game first came out. I'm not getting as many of those dopamine bursts from finding rare cards, and my list of Wonder Picks to choose from has been pretty garbage too.
Maybe a better battle meta can fix some of that malaise. In addition to the new set, one leaker is also claiming that a ranked mode is coming in March. Competitive play has been requested since launch, and it would certainly give players something new to grind for, especially if there are decent rewards for hitting new ranks besides just bragging rights or trophy emblems. Though some players are already cracking jokes. 'Competitive coin flipping,' wrote one fans. 'What a time to be alive.'
One thing we do know is that Pokémon TCG Pocket will not be part of the Pokémon World Championship anytime soon. 'At this time there are no plans for Pokémon Pocket to join, but we're always looking at things,' director of esports for the franchise Chris Brown said in an interview last week.

TikTok star Khaby Lame leaves US after being detained by immigration officials
Khaby Lame, considered the most popular TikTok star in the world, has left the US after being detained by immigration officials. The influencer was detained in Las Vegas on Friday for allegedly staying in the country after his visa expired. He then voluntarily departed, but officials did not say which day he left. Lame is one of hundreds of people caught in US President Donald Trump's immigration crackdown, which includes cross-country raids and an increasing number of deportations, and which has also sparked days of protest against Immigration and Customs Enforcement. Lame has not publicly commented on his voluntary departure, leaving fans guessing about when he left and where he is now. ICE has said he arrived in the US on 30 April and then overstayed his visa. Officials said he was released the same day he was detained and subsequently left the country. A voluntary departure allows people who are facing removal from the US to avoid having a deportation order on their immigration record. Deportation orders can prevent immigrants from being allowed back into the US for up to a decade. The 25-year-old Senegalese-Italian influencer, who has 162.3 million TikTok followers, became popular during the pandemic for his silent videos and signature facial expressions. Who has been arrested by ICE under Trump? "It's my face and my expressions which make people laugh," Lame told The New York Times in 2021, adding that his reactions speak "a global language". As an Italian citizen, he is allowed to travel to the US for business or tourism for up to 90 days without a visa. Lame attended the Met Gala in May. Otherwise, it is unclear what he was doing while in the US. His deportation has made headlines as he is one of the more high-profile people to be deported in Trump's latest surge to cut illegal immigration into the country. Some 51,000 undocumented migrants were in Immigrations and Customs Enforcement (ICE) detention as of early June - the highest on record since September 2019.

Alex Warren Responds to Backlash Over Sabrina Carpenter Post as 'Manchild' Rivals His Song for No. 1 Spot on Charts
Alex Warren responded to backlash after posting a link to Sabrina Carpenter's latest single, "Manchild," on his Instagram Stories on Monday, June 9 The musician's hit song "Ordinary," which is in its second week at No. 1 on the Billboard Hot 100, is being challenged by "Manchild" for the top spot on next week's chart Warren addressed the negativity he received on X, calling Carpenter's single a "great record"Talent respects talent. Alex Warren, 24, showed his support for Sabrina Carpenter, 26, after the release of her latest single "Manchild" on Monday, June 10, by posting a Spotify link to her newly-released song. However, his seemingly kind gesture sparked apparent backlash from fans on social media. The TikTok star-turned-musician, whose hit "Ordinary" is in its second week at No. 1 on the Billboard Hot 100, received mixed feelings from fans as Carpenter's latest single is challenging him for the top spot on next week's Billboard Hot 100. Warren called out the negativity on X later that day, emphasizing his intentions with the Instagram Stories post and making clear his support of Carpenter despite competition on the music charts. "Wait why is everyone so mean on here… music is music. I'm so blessed to be on the chart and I'm also so happy for all the wins in music," he began in the post. "Manchild is such a great record and I'm so honored to be mentioned in the same sentence as Sabrina." Warren concluded, "Ordinary means so much to me and so many people and it's totally ok if it doesn't to you. I'm just happy to be here:)." Users came to his defense, writing words of support under his post. "Can we normalize not harassing artists for no reason at all?! Everyone works hard for their records," wrote one user. "Twitter is not a nice place. IGNORE These trolls," commented another. "Some of us are mature and normal enough to stream both songs and support u both! Thank you for being respectful and not spreading hate towards Sabrina or any other artist," penned a third. Carpenter debuted "Manchild" on June 5 through Island Records, and the accompanying music video was released the following day. In February 2025, Warren's "Ordinary" was released through Atlantic Records as the lead single from his upcoming debut studio album,You'll Be Alright, Kid. Warren previously explained the meaning behind his song, "Ordinary," which he said was inspired by his wife, Kouvr Annon. The couple, who initially found fame as members of the content creation hub Hype House, wed in June 2024. The same month "Ordinary" was released, Annon posted a TikTok in which she compiled clips of Warren performing. "When you watch the person you love do the thing they love most in the world," she wrote at the time. She captioned the post, "I'm the worlds most proud musician wife."
